Fisher Asset Management, LLC, operating as Fisher Investments, was founded in 1979 by Ken Fisher and is headquartered in Plano, Texas, following a relocation from Camas, Washington, in 2023. As an independent, fee-only investment adviser, it manages over $275 billion in assets for individual and institutional investors globally as of June 2024, offering tailored portfolio management through its Private Client Group and Institutional Group. Known for its active, top-down investment approach guided by a five-member Investment Policy Committee, the firm emphasizes asset allocation and has expanded internationally with offices in eight countries, including a wholly owned subsidiary, Fisher Investments Europe Limited, in London. With Ken Fisher as executive chairman and co-chief investment officer, succeeded as CEO by Damian Ornani in 2016, Fisher Investments blends a legacy of innovation with a client-first philosophy, recently spinning off its 401(k) Solutions into Fisher Retirement Solutions in 2024.

Fisher Asset Management's Q4 2023 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2023, Fisher Asset Management held 1,269 positions worth $189B, up 7.3% from $176B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 31% of the portfolio.

Fisher Asset Management withdrew a net $8.48B in Q4 2023, closing 288 positions and reducing 487 holdings. Its most notable exit was SIEMENS AKTIENGESELLSCHAFT ADS, an estimated $828M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 30% of assets, up from 27%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, Fisher Asset Management opened a new position in Veralto worth $93.6M.
